How to Outsmart Cybercriminals: 5 Essential Tips to Protect Yourself from Online Scams
The digital landscape is constantly evolving, and unfortunately, so are the tactics used by cybercriminals. The days of easily spotting a scammer through poor grammar and unbelievable stories are mostly behind us. Today, online scams are highly sophisticated, often utilizing artificial intelligence and psychological manipulation to bypass our natural defenses.
Modern threats are designed to look legitimate, making anyone a potential target regardless of their technical expertise. To navigate the web safely, users need to adopt proactive security habits. Here are five practical, highly effective tips to protect your personal information and outsmart modern scams.
1. Adopt a "Zero Trust" Approach to Messages
In the world of enterprise cybersecurity, there is a concept called "Zero Trust," which means never trusting a connection automatically, no matter where it comes from. This mindset is highly effective for personal security as well. Scams are engineered to trigger an emotional response—usually fear (e.g., "Your account has been locked!") or greed (e.g., "You have won a gift card!"). If an unsolicited email, text, or direct message creates a sense of urgency: 1. Pause and verify: Never click the link provided in the message. 2. Go directly to the source: Manually open your browser, type in the official website of the bank or service, and check your account status there. Using a single email address for everything—from your main bank account to a random newsletter you signed up for—creates a massive vulnerability. If one low-security website suffers a data breach, your primary inbox is exposed to phishing attacks. The solution is compartmentalization. Use different email addresses for different purposes. Many email providers and privacy tools now offer "email aliasing" services (like Apple's Hide My Email or simple forwarding services). These allow you to generate a unique, random email address for every new website you join. While having a strong password is a good start, it is no longer enough to stop modern online scams. Two-Factor Authentication (2FA) is essential, but the method you choose matters significantly. Relying on SMS text messages for your 2FA codes leaves you vulnerable to "SIM swapping," a technique where scammers trick your mobile carrier into transferring your phone number to their device. 1. The Upgrade: Switch to an Authenticator App (such as Google Authenticator, Authy, or Microsoft Authenticator). 2. The Best Defense: Wherever possible, adopt Passkeys. Look Beyond the "Green Padlock"
One of the most dangerous misconceptions in web security is the belief that the padlock icon next to a website's URL means the site is entirely safe and legitimate. The padlock simply indicates that the site has an SSL certificate, meaning the connection between your browser and the server is encrypted. However, anyone can obtain an SSL certificate for free—including scammers. If you are connected to a fraudulent website, the padlock just means your data is being securely delivered straight to the attackers.
